Project Type Typical Range
Crack Repair $1,200 - $2,800
Surface Resurfacing $2,500 - $6,000
Full-Depth Repair $5,000 - $12,000
Patch Repairs $1,500 - $3,500
Structural Repair $8,000 - $20,000
Surface Coating $2,000 - $4,500

Factors Affecting Cost

Aggregate concrete repair involves restoring damaged or deteriorated concrete surfaces by addressing issues such as cracking, spalling, or surface wear. The scope of work can vary depending on the extent of damage and the desired finish, making it a common choice for maintaining structural integrity and appearance.

  • Materials: Typically includes concrete patching compounds, aggregates, bonding agents, and sealers suitable for repair work.
  • Size and Scope: Ranges from small patches to extensive surface restorations, depending on the extent of damage.
  • Labor Complexity: Varies from straightforward surface patching to more involved procedures requiring surface preparation and finishing.
  • Permitting: Usually requires minimal or no permits, though local regulations should be checked for large-scale repairs.
  • Additional Services: May include surface grinding, sealing, or waterproofing to enhance durability and appearance.

Project Size and Scope

Scope/Size Typical Range
Small cracks or surface defects $50 - $200 per repair
Localized patching of damaged areas $200 - $600 per section
Extensive surface repair or overlay $1,000 - $3,000
Full-depth repair for large sections $3,000 - $10,000+

Costs can vary based on project specifics, material requirements, and site conditions.
